Floating Drug Delivery Systems Using Metronidazole as a Model Drug Part I: By Effervescent Method
Gastric retentive dosage forms are highly useful for the delivery of many kinds of drugs. The use of floating dosage forms (FDFs) is one of the methods used to achieve prolonged gastric residence time (GRT).
